摘要

LC-MS/MS, a method of choice for high-throughput qualitative and quantitative proteomic analysis, has been applied in post-genomic studies of two halophilic archaeal model organisms, H. salinarum andHaloarcula marismotui, that we have sequenced. Using simple label-free approach, we identified several new structural proteins of gas vesicles (an intracellular organelle for adjusting the buoyancy of the cell), distinguished a number of membrane and soluble proteins, and characterized the systems fluctuations under metabolic stress or heat shock conditions. By considering reaction connectivity and proteins with major and minor expression differences, systems level changes were revealed with increased confidence. Thus even proteomic analysis has relatively limited protein coverage as well as apparently limited quantitative reliability, interesting biological aspects could still be revealed with pertinent data analysis strategy.
